Hi all, My supervisor has asked me to come up with a way to allow certain users in our office the ability to change some attributes of the GAL, such as users telephone numbers. What is the best way to do something like this? I'm considering a taskpad of AD Users and Computers; but then, I guess I would need to install Exchange System Manager on any machine that was going to be used to make these changes? That doesn't strike me as a particularly elegant or secure solution. Any thoughts or alternatives would be much appreciated. Thanks, --Al Puzzuoli
